  • Profile picture of the author Zeus66
    I'm with you. I have about 150 sites running Adsense and my CTR has taken a huge hit this month. However - and this is all I care about in the long run - my income did not take a hit.

    So, either something's screwy with Google's stats reporting (my personal opinion), or somehow ad targeting went screwy, which would cause a sharp drop in CTR - BUT the clicks are paying a lot more, which would offset the big drop in CTR.

    Like I said, I suspect the problem is with the reporting of the stats, not the alternative. It would be too much of a coincidence to see such a big drop in CTR across as many sites as I have with Adsense on them, but not see any real significant ding to my income. Gotta be that the stats are out of kilter.

  • Profile picture of the author debra
    If your showing higher impressions than usual and no clicks...

    Look at your eCPM...

    You may be stuck providing space for banner media buys. Google bought out Double Click and is serving media buys through them. Because their statics interface has not been merged, and we don't know when it will, so you won't be able to see any clicks because it is recorded on doubleclicks system.

    Depending on your unigue traffic, you might see a couple of cents in the last column that makes it look like you made a couple of cents for NO clicks. Hummm...since when has Google been known to give away money?
